Transaction 3518834ac937b3ec8db20d5236cab1d75704b25d8a8701705f2096126f315807
1 Input
1 Output
-
3518834ac937b3ec8db20d5236cab1d75704b25d8a8701705f2096126f315807:0
- value
- 6774250
- script pubkey
- OP_0 OP_PUSHBYTES_20 e83dcb2705faef06b9272a700bea860f389f08fe
- address
- bc1qaq7ukfc9lthsdwf89fcqh65xpuuf7z87mwa3y6